The Visual Superiority of UV Ink Technology

The mechanical precision of our process allows for resolutions ranging from 720 to 2880 dpi. This level of detail is achieved directly on textured surfaces like brick, concrete, or wood, which were previously difficult to decorate. The secret lies in the instant curing process; high-intensity UV light solidifies the ink immediately upon contact with the wall. This ensures the finish is durable and smudge-proof from the second the machine passes. For brands with strict colour guidelines, this technology offers industrial accuracy, matching corporate palettes with a level of precision that traditional paint or digital wallpaper simply cannot replicate. Technical Guidance: Surfaces, Durability, and Installation

Direct-to-wall printing is an engineering-led solution for the modern office wall. Our equipment uses advanced laser sensors to track the surface profile in real-time, maintaining a consistent distance from the substrate regardless of its texture. This allows us to achieve high-resolution results on a versatile range of materials, including plaster, brick, concrete, glass, and wood. Unlike traditional panels that require drilling and mounting, our process applies the design directly, preserving the structural integrity of your building whilst creating a seamless finish.

Safety and compliance are central to our service. In a commercial setting, fire-rating standards are critical. The UV-curable inks we use are non-flammable and designed for indoor applications, meeting the necessary safety requirements for UK office environments. Because the ink cures instantly under high-intensity UV light, there are no lingering chemical odours or harmful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s) to worry about. This technical precision ensures a durable, scratch-resistant surface that handles the daily traffic of a busy workspace without degrading.

Printing on Industrial Textures: Brick and Concrete

Industrial aesthetics like exposed brick and raw concrete are popular in 2026, but they are notoriously difficult to decorate with traditional methods. Our technology adapts to these irregular surfaces, ensuring the ink penetrates the pores of the material for a genuine “painted-on” look. The result is a high-resolution graphic that retains the unique character of the substrate. Whether the surface is porous concrete or smooth glass, the UV curing process guarantees maximum adhesion. It’s a permanent solution that won’t lift, bubble, or peel, even in environments with fluctuating temperatures or humidity.

The Installation Journey: From Brief to Completion

The process is streamlined to minimise downtime. It begins with your high-resolution digital files; we recommend a minimum of 300 dpi to ensure sharpness at large scales. On the day of installation, our team requires a standard 240v power source and a clear path of approximately 1.5 metres in front of the office wall. Because there’s no paste, water, or cutting involved, your team can continue their work in the same room whilst we print. It’s a clean, efficient operation that respects your business hours. Maintenance is equally straightforward. The cured surface is water-resistant and can be cleaned using a soft cloth and mild detergent. There’s no need for specialised chemicals or protective coatings, as the UV-cured ink is inherently robust. This longevity makes it a superior choice for high-traffic areas where traditional wall coverings would quickly show signs of wear and tear.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can you print on an office wall that isn’t perfectly flat?

Yes, our equipment is designed to handle irregular and textured surfaces with precision. We use laser-guided sensors that track the wall’s profile in real-time, allowing the print heads to adjust their position automatically. This ensures a consistent, high-resolution finish on substrates like exposed brick, concrete, and even wood, where traditional vinyl would fail to adhere.

Is direct-to-wall printing more expensive than traditional wallpaper?

Direct-to-wall printing is a high-value investment that starts from £120 per square metre. Whilst the initial cost might be higher than budget paper, it’s often more economical than bespoke, high-end wallpaper or industrial vinyl. You save on the costs of adhesives, professional hanging services, and the inevitable repairs needed when traditional materials begin to peel or bubble in high-traffic areas.

How long does it take to print a full-sized office mural?

The printing speed typically ranges from 1.2 to 2.0 square metres per hour, depending on the chosen resolution. For a standard office wall measuring 10 square metres, the on-site printing process usually takes between 5 and 7 hours. This allows us to complete most transformations within a single shift, ensuring minimal disruption to your daily operations.

What happens if we need to change our branding or move offices?

Our printed art is permanent but can be easily updated or removed by painting over it. Because the UV-cured ink layer is incredibly thin, you don’t need to strip any material; just apply two coats of high-quality emulsion to return the surface to a blank canvas. It’s a much cleaner and faster process than removing industrial wallpaper, which frequently damages the plaster underneath.

Are the UV inks used in wall printing safe for indoor environments?

The inks we use are specifically formulated for indoor safety and meet all relevant UK fire-rating standards. They cure instantly under UV light, which means there’s no drying time and zero emissions of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s). Your team can remain in the room whilst we work because there are no harmful fumes or lingering chemical odours.

Do I need to prepare my office wall before the printing team arrives?

The office wall simply needs to be clean, dry, and free from any protruding screws or nails. We recommend a light-coloured, matte-finish base for the best results, though we can print on darker surfaces if required. Our technical team provides a full preparation guide during the initial consultation to ensure the substrate is ready for the industrial print heads.

Is the printed art resistant to scratches and cleaning chemicals?

UV-curable ink is exceptionally durable and resistant to the typical scuffs found in busy workspaces. The finished surface is water-resistant and can be cleaned using a soft cloth with mild household detergents. You don’t need to worry about the colours fading or the image smudging, as the bond between the ink and the wall is designed for long-term commercial use.

Can you print high-resolution photographs directly onto the wall?

We can reproduce any digital image, including complex photography and intricate gradients, with absolute clarity. Our technology supports resolutions up to 2880 dpi, which is far superior to the grainy output of standard large-format printers. This allows for immersive, photographic murals that look as sharp from a distance as they do from a few centimetres away.
